					Installed..  Those rear brackets are fiddly but overall looks solid and a neat fit.
 
 The technique that worked in the end on the rear brackets.
 
 - tape the rear brackets to the roof trim so you don't need to hold it.
 - Slide the capture bracket piece in that's attached to the wire and using some pressure on the wire against the opening where you slid it in from, hold it there when alligned with the hold for the bolt.
 - may take quite a few goes to get the bolt to catch the capture bracket but it should eventually.  Only needs a 1/10th of a turn to initially engage
 - stop swearing..stretch the legs and back.  The rest takes only a few minutes to put in.
 - easiest to put in and remove the barrier with the rear seats down at floor level and in through the 2nd row passenger doors.
